The Paradox of Attrition: How Ukraine is Making Russia’s Air Defenses More Dangerous to NATO
The ongoing war in Ukraine, while demonstrating the resilience of Ukrainian forces and the limitations of Russian military doctrine, is simultaneously creating a more formidable adversary for NATO in the form of a battle-hardened and increasingly sophisticated Russian air defense network. A recent report by Justin Bronk, an air power expert at the UK’s Royal United Services Institute (RUSI), warns that Russia’s air defenses now pose a greater threat to NATO air forces than they did before the 2022 invasion. This isn’t simply a matter of maintaining numbers; it’s a story of adaptation, experience, and a dangerous paradox: destruction of systems in Ukraine is inadvertently enhancing Russia’s overall air defense capability. The implications are significant, forcing a reassessment of Western airpower doctrine and accelerating the need for substantial investment in countermeasures.

Background & Context: A History of Russian Air Defense Dominance
Russia has long prioritized integrated air defense systems (IADS), viewing them as crucial for protecting its vast territory and projecting power. This emphasis stems from historical vulnerabilities – particularly the memory of devastating air raids during World War II – and a strategic doctrine that anticipates potential conflicts with technologically advanced adversaries. Before the invasion of Ukraine, Russia possessed the largest and most layered IADS in Europe, comprised of long-range systems like the S-400 Triumf, medium-range systems like the Buk-M2, and shorter-range platforms.
The conflict in Ukraine initially appeared to present an opportunity to degrade this network. Ukrainian forces, aided by Western intelligence and weaponry, have achieved a “steady drumbeat” of successes against Russian air defense assets, utilizing drones, artillery, and missiles. However, this attrition has not resulted in a weakened Russia, but rather a catalyst for rapid learning and adaptation. This represents a shift from the pre-2022 assumption that simply degrading the quantity of Russian systems would inherently diminish the threat. What’s often overlooked is that military technology isn’t static; it evolves through real-world application, and the Ukrainian theater has become a brutal, high-stakes testing ground for Russian air defense doctrine.
The Combat Edge: Experience, Upgrades, and Coordination
Bronk’s analysis, based on interviews with Western air forces, data from Ukraine, and open-source intelligence, highlights three key areas of improvement. First, Russian crews are now “significantly more combat-experienced” than they were before the invasion. This isn’t merely about hours logged; it’s about learning to operate in a contested environment, adapting to Ukrainian tactics, and refining procedures under fire. Second, Russia continues to produce and deploy newer, more capable systems like the S-350 Vityaz, mitigating some of the losses incurred in Ukraine. Crucially, these systems aren’t being deployed in isolation.
The most significant development, however, is the improved coordination between Russian air defense assets and other elements of its military. Ukraine has observed Russia increasingly integrating its long-range surface-to-air missiles with fighter jets and A-50U airborne early warning and control (AEW&C) aircraft. This allows them to extend the range of their missiles and engage targets that would previously have been beyond their reach. This signals a move towards a more networked and proactive air defense posture, making it significantly harder for NATO aircraft to operate effectively in a contested airspace. The sheer volume of these systems – “several hundred batteries” remain in service – combined with this enhanced coordination, presents a daunting challenge.
What This Means: Implications for NATO and Beyond
The implications of Bronk’s findings are far-reaching. For NATO, it necessitates a fundamental reassessment of its airpower doctrine, which traditionally relies on achieving rapid air superiority as a prerequisite for ground operations. The prospect of facing a highly capable and experienced Russian IADS in Europe raises serious questions about NATO’s ability to quickly suppress or destroy these defenses, a critical step before deploying air assets. This is particularly concerning given that NATO’s own arsenal of ground-based air defenses is comparatively smaller than Russia’s.
The increased threat also has significant budgetary implications. NATO members have already committed to increased defense spending, but this report underscores the urgent need to prioritize investment in advanced electronic warfare capabilities, anti-radiation missiles, and long-range standoff weapons designed to neutralize enemy air defenses. For policymakers, it highlights the importance of understanding that simply providing Ukraine with aid isn’t solely about bolstering Kyiv’s defenses; it’s also about gaining invaluable intelligence on Russian tactics and capabilities. The public should be aware that a potential conflict with Russia would likely be far more challenging and protracted than previously anticipated, requiring a sustained and comprehensive commitment to defense preparedness.
